'Mamata has insulted people by not attending Basu's funeral'

Last Updated: Thursday, January 21, 2010, 23:43
Views 678 Comments 1  
New Delhi: Trinamool Congress chief Mamata Banerjee has "insulted" the people of West Bengal by not attending the funeral of Marxist stalwart Jyoti Basu, CPI(M) leader Sitaram Yechury said on Thursday.

"By not attending (the funeral) and justifying her absence, she has insulted the people of Bengal who turned out in lakhs. Now they will have to decide," he told reporters when asked to comment on the Railway Minister's absence at the funeral on Tuesday.

He said despite serious political differences, it was a culture not only in India but abroad also that "you be present on such occasions. It is also elementary human decency and a matter of courtesy and political morality".

Yechury said the fact that so many people turned out in such large numbers reflected the popularity of the great leader.
